My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

My name is Asteroid, and I am a gorgeous 2 yo long haired black and brown GSD. I was found tied up to a fire hydrant in front of the Richmond, CA. Shelter and was taken to the Martinez Shelter where I ended up on death row.

Luckily, Martina Animal Rescue saved me from the shelter at the 11th hour. I was in a foster home briefly, but it wasn't a good situation. They kept me outside all the time in a very small crate where I couldn't even move around. So, I was placed in a boarding kennel until I find my forever home. I have been there for more than a year. I really like the people there and I make the best of it, but it sure would be nice to have a home and family of my very own. They do tell me every day that I am a great dog and that they love me and this makes me feel so happy.❤️

I just found out that the Boarding Kennel I am in is closing at the end of this month. I don't know where I am going to go now and I am very worried and sad. I hope I don't end up back at the scary shelter.

I am reserved and nervous when I meet new people (especially men). I think this is because my original human abandoned me. But, once I know you and trust you, I am a very loving and affectionate dog. My humans tell me I am smart, curious, love taking walks and am easy to train because I love their treats. I also really like meeting other dogs and playing with them. My friends tell me that I would make an excellent personal protective dog.

More about this rescue

We are a non-profit rescue organization who helps rescue dogs and sometimes other animals from Contra Costa Animal Services as well as other local shelters; usually the scared, overlooked or often the ones off the euthanasia list. We also rescue dogs who have been injured or abandoned trying to keep them from having to go into the shelter after looking for an owner. We then place them in foster homes to decompress and learn to be part of a family as well as learn structure and boundaries. If needed and we can, we also have trainers that help prepare our dogs for adoption.
